I was diagnosed with nueroendocrine islet cell tumor of the pancreas in June of 2006.  I was referred by my oncologist in my home town to Dr. Larry Kvols at the Moffitt Cancer Center in Tampa, FL.  Dr. Kvols is world renowned in the specialty of neuroendocrine tumors.  I was on a clinical trial with Dr. Kvols had a good response and I am doing well.  Moffitt Cancer Center is a research center and Dr. Kvols does his research specfically in nueroendocrine tumors.
